Peking duck is a conventional Chinese dish that originated in Beijing. It’s produced by roasting a whole duck right up until the pores and skin is crispy and golden, and also the meat is tender and juicy. Go Here The dish is usually served with slim pancakes, scallions, and a sweet hoisin sauce.
